Public bug reported:
I try to select "Publish" in Qt Creator, and select "Build and Validate
click package". However, I do not get any clue about where to find the
click package. Previously, it showed that it was somewhere under "/tmp"
directory. Now, it seems there is no message for it at all. It would be
good to show where to find the click package file since a developer may
need it to publish the app.
